Feeling wronged or betrayed can gnaw at your peace, but what if we could transform these experiences into opportunities for growth? On "Let it Be Easy," I unpack a dinner table conversation where we explored the age-old human experience of feeling slighted or unfairly treated. Drawing from ancient scriptures and modern hustles, this episode reveals that these emotions aren’t new or unique to you; they’re woven into the fabric of our shared history. A successful entrepreneur at our gathering shared her personal insights on how increased success often corresponds with increased opportunities for others to act unfavorably. We explored how the sheer volume of actions in a thriving life naturally leads to more instances of potential betrayal or disappointment.
